Invisible aligners (also called clear aligners or transparent teeth braces) are a modern, removable orthodontic solution for teeth straightening. They are made of high-quality, medical-grade transparent plastic that fits snugly over your teeth.
Unlike traditional braces, aligners don’t use brackets and wires. Instead, you receive a set of custom-made trays that gradually shift your teeth into the desired position. Every 1–2 weeks, you switch to a new set of aligners until your treatment is complete.
Traditional braces use metal brackets and wires attached to the teeth to apply constant pressure, moving teeth into alignment. While they are effective for even the most complex cases, they are highly visible, require regular tightening at the dental clinic, and can be uncomfortable.

One of the main reasons people choose clear braces or transparent braces is appearance. Invisible aligners are barely noticeable, making them ideal for professionals, students, or anyone who prefers a discreet treatment.
In contrast, metal braces are more visible, though ceramic braces can blend better with teeth.
